Legendary player Datuk Jamal Nasir publicly criticized coach Nafuzi Zain for not calling up the Malaysian U23 team for the FIFA Days of November 10-18, warning of the risk of being eliminated by Vietnam at the SEA Games 33 due to stalled preparations.

Datuk Jamal Nasir has sharply criticized the Malaysian U23 team under coach Nafuzi Zain for not taking advantage of the FIFA Days from November 10-18 to train, play friendly matches, and finalize their squad for the 33rd SEA Games. He fears that the Malaysian U23 team, drawn in the same group as Vietnam, could pay the price for their passive preparation.

Missing FIFA Days and a warning from a Malaysian legend.

“I really don’t understand why Nafuzi isn’t taking advantage of this moment… This is the perfect opportunity to call up players, test the lineup, and start building the core team for the SEA Games. But now, precious time is slipping away,” Jamal Nasir emphasized.

According to him, FIFA Days are designed for friendly matches, training, and player evaluation. Not focusing during this period is a "serious waste," especially when the team needs to set standards, build confidence, and provide real-world match experience for young players.

SEA Games outside of FIFA's schedule and the personnel challenge.

The SEA Games are taking place outside of the FIFA calendar, meaning persuading clubs to release players will be more difficult than usual. Jamal Nasir believes that this is why the November training camp is the "ideal time" to organize friendly matches, assess the squad, and finalize the personnel.

Without test matches, the youth team lacks real-world data to assess positions, test substitutions, implement pressing principles, or organize set pieces. These are details that require time to accumulate and are difficult to compensate for close to match day.

In the same group as Vietnam, and at risk of elimination.

Being drawn in the same group as Vietnam means the preparation standards must be even stricter. Jamal Nasir expressed concern that his team could be eliminated by Vietnam if they enter the tournament with an unformed squad and lacking rhythm in their play.

Tactical impact from missed preparation time.

By skipping the period from November 10-18, the Malaysian U23 team missed the opportunity to test their formation, passing triangles, and attacking-defensive transition strategies. These tactical "automations," which require practice through actual match minutes, cannot be replaced by short training sessions.

Recent performance and the pressure on coach Nafuzi Zain

Pressure mounts on coach Nafuzi Zain as the Malaysian U23 team has been eliminated early from the Southeast Asian U23 Championship and finished only third in the Asian U23 Championship qualifiers. The quietness in their preparations this time around further fuels doubts about the ambitions of the "Malaysian Tigers" at the 33rd SEA Games in Thailand.
